The image depicts a sunken garden on the Mrs. Gage Estate, located on West Main Street in Shrewsbury, Massachusetts. The garden features a symmetrical layout with stone-bordered paths and neatly maintained hedges. Two trees are visible in the foreground and a set of stone steps leads up at the far end of the garden. There are several trees and a broad landscape visible in the background.
